Cabinet Delivery Groups were set up under the Second Administration (2003-2007). Delivery Groups operated in areas where the Executive's policy was already well defined. Their role was to scope a work programme and oversee its delivery. Each Group identified the outcomes that Ministers wanted to see and set targets for measuring progress. Delivery Groups consisted of relevant Ministers supported by a key senior official who was commissioned to lead a team across the Executive to take forward the Group's work programme and report back to the Group on a regular basis.
